We've uploaded a new installer that will update your game to version 1.0.6. Please download the new installer at your earliest convenience in order to get the latest and greatest version of the game :)

Changes in version 1.0.6:


FEATURES:
Added controller sensitivity options

GAMEPLAY CHANGES:
*Altered Magic Boomerang's spell behavior:
*On Spell: If the spell hits an enemy, a mana boomerang is launched towards the player. Catching it restores some of the cost of the spell.

Design Context: Magic Boomerang? More like Magic BoomeRANGE. In a lot of situations, the interesting decisions involved in high-grade Magic Boomerang spells included "can I click on my target" and "how high can I set my monitor resolution". They bypassed a lot of important pacing systems (namely spell range) which resulted in them being "fun because powerful" and not "fun because interesting". We're not hating on spell-snipers here, though! We love Quicksilver Gear and Rock and if you want to hit from miles away you've still got options.

This change was also to help out some underappreciated materials such as Philosopher Stone and Soul Contract. By giving a skill-based avenue to mitigating these costs, we hope to have opened up some exciting paths of spellcrafting.

*Rift Crystal robes are now capped at 50% dodge chance.
*On-hit effects are now triggered if you execute a target on spell hit

BUG FIXES:
*Fixed issues with fullscreen on some machines
*Enemies now ignore New Game+ scaling in training courses
*Cauldrons in the Castle Zone now properly interact with Laser spells
*Spell recipes can now be deleted from mission select crafting menus
*Fixed an issue with spell icons not functioning properly in New Game+ mode
*Fixed an issue with the final boss dying before being encountered
*Fixed a rare situation where no leaf piles would spawn in the mission whose objective is to remove all leaf piles
*Level portals no longer get embedded in the environment
*Fixed an bug that caused erratic behavior in the tutorial during New Game+
*Ninja Sword trail particles no longer persist longer than intended
*Secondary effects on spells are no longer editable on graphics settings that don't display them in the first place
*The New Game+ prompt should only show up once now
*Fixed an issue where super clever wizards were getting negative times on training courses
